Compare all specifications:
1958 Porsche 356 | 1978 Isuzu Florian | |
Make | Porsche | Isuzu |
Model | 356 | Florian |
Year Released | 1958 | 1978 |
Engine Position | Rear | Front |
Engine Size | 1486 cc | 1817 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| boxer | in-line |
Horse Power | 0 HP | 98 HP |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line |
Drive Type | Rear | Rear |
Transmission Type | Manual | Automatic |
Number of Seats | 2 seats | 4 seats |
Vehicle Weight | 785 kg | 1025 kg |
Vehicle Length | 3960 mm | 4440 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1680 mm | 1610 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1320 mm | 1450 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2110 mm | 2510 mm |
